Description
Studio portrait of Charlemae Hill Rollins.
Charlemae Hill Rollins (1897-1979) was a pioneering librarian, author and storyteller in the area of African-American literature. During her thirty-one years as head librarian of the children’s department at the Chicago Public Library as well as after her retirement, she instituted substantial reforms in children’s literature.
Written on back of photo: Charlemae Hill Rollins 1897-1979, distinguished librarian, noted author, dedicated humanitarian, crusader against stereotypes...
